The russian concert hall shooting was a brutal attack that took place at the Crocus City Hall near Moscow on March 23, 2024. The attack resulted in the deaths of at least 137 people and injured many more. Four men have been arrested and placed in pre-trial detention in connection with the attack. The attack was claimed by ISIS, and a video released by an ISIS-affiliated news agency showed the attackers opening fire inside the Crocus City Hall complex.
